MOLECULAR PHYLOGENETIC ANALYSIS OF RARE SILENEAE SPECIES OF THE UKRAINIAN FLORA

Abstract

The tribe Sileneae DC. (Caryophyllaceae) is estimated to contain 59 species in the Ukrainian flora, seven of which are listed in the Red Data Book of Ukraine (2009). Some of these taxa still do not have any registered sequences in the GenBank. The aim of the present study is to infer phylogenetic relationships of Ukrainian rare species within the Sileneae tribe from nucleotide variation in the nrDNA. ITS1-5.8S-ITS2 regions were sequenced for 11 taxa (12 sequences in total): Lychnis chalcedonica L., L. flos-cuculi L., Silene baccifera (L.) Roth, S. chlorantha (Willd.) Ehrh., S. cretacea Fisch. ex Spreng., S. frivaldszkyana Hampe (2 sequences), S. sytnikii Krytzka, Novosad et Protopopova, S. syreistschikowii P. Smirn., S. supina M. Bieb., S. vulgaris (Moench) Garcke, and S. zawadzkii Herbich. In addition to the obtained nrDNA fragments, 39 sequences of Sileneae were imported from GenBank. Agrostemma githago L. JN589107 was used as an outgroup. In total, 51 sequences were used to reconstruct the phylogeny using Bayesian inference. In the obtained phylogenetic tree, five major branches are observed: Atocion, Viscaria, Heliosperma, Lychnis, and Silene. Two rare species – Atocion lithuanicum (Zapał.) Tzvel. and A. hypanicum (Klok.) Tzvel. – are placed within Atocion clade. Endemic Heliosperma carpaticum (Zapał.) Klok. is sister to H. alpestre (Jacq.) Griseb. Viscaria and Lychnis clades do not contain any rare taxa. Four subclades are observed in Silene. The Carpathian endemic Silene zawadzkii (=Silenanthe zawadzkii (Herbich) Griseb. et Schenk, = Elisanthe zawadzkii (Herbich) Klok.) is sister to S. viscosa Pers. (=Carpophora viscosa (L.) Tzvelev, = Elisanthe viscosa (L.) Rupr.), but not to S. noctiflora (=Elisanthe noctiflora (L.) Willk.) and is nested within the second subclade of Silene. Other rare taxa are placed within the fourth subclade. Endemic to Eastern Crimea S. syreistschikowii forms a clade with closely related S. supina M. Bieb. Sister to them is S. cappadocica Boiss. & Heldr., which belongs to the same section Spergulifoliae Boiss. Widely distributed species in Southern Europe, but rare in Ukraine S. viridiflora L. has sister relationship to S. nutans L.; S. italica (L.) Pers. and S. nemoralis Waldst. & Kit. are also related to them. These four species belong to Silene sect. Siphonomorpha Otth. Ukrainian local endemic species S. sytnikii forms a single clade with Balkanian S. frivaldszkyana Hampe. Rare species S. cretacea is, surprisingly, sister to a group of taxa with small unisexual flowers from the sect. Otites (Adans.) Otth, but with low posterior probability.
